Founder and Director of Sense of Self, Kate is dedicated to accessing the innate wisdom of the body through touch. She works with the young and old in a variety of individual and group settings to uplift the individual psyche while promoting peace and well being for all of humanity from the inside out. Kate combines eight years of extensive training and experience in yoga and the healing arts with her education and expertise in herbal medicine, indigenous philosophy, and nature awareness to offer her students and clients a dynamic approach to expanded body/mind awareness, personal growth, vision, and healing.
Kate is nationally certified in therapeutic massage & bodywork and is an internationally certified educator of infant massage through Infant Massage USA, the official US Affiliate of the International Association of Infant Massage. She is an internationally certified kundalini yoga teacher through the Kundalini Research Institute with specialized training to teach kundalini yoga during pregnancy and practice pre and perinatal massage. She holds a bachelor's degree in Human Health and Development from Prescott College in Northern Arizona and has worked in conjunction with families, counselors, chiropractors, pain management doctors, and a special needs facility for adults. Currently, Kate has a private energy healing and therapeutic massage practice in the Los Angeles area and teaches infant massage to parents in various locations throughout Santa Monica and LA.
Kate embraces the ancient healing art of massage and the teachings of kundalini yoga as sources of inspiration and elevation for all people regardless of age, class, gender, religious affiliation, or sexual orientation. Kate's passion for teaching and practicing bodywork comes from her desire to encourage people to awaken to the infinite potential they possess as human beings.
